PARO Therapeutic Robot

PARO is a baby seal that does not need feeding, but still expects attention.

An interactive robotic baby seal designed for therapeutic use in dementia and care settings.

Worth knowing

A useful reality check

PARO is designed for therapeutic and care settings. It can complement human support, but should not be presented as a replacement for care.

Our take

Why it caught our eye

The interactive robotic seal is designed for therapeutic and care settings, responding as a companion object rather than a conventional toy. Its strongest idea is emotional presence, while human support remains central to how it should be used.
